System::Collections::IListImplRefType sınıfı
İçindekiler
[
Saklamak
]IListImplRefType class
System::Collections::IList arayüzünü System::Collections::Generic::List nesnesi üzerinde uygulayan stub. Referans tipleri için uygulama.
template<typename T>class IListImplRefType : public virtual System::Collections::IList
Yöntemler
| Yöntem | Açıklama |
|---|---|
| Add(SharedPtr<System::Object>) override | Liste sonuna bir öğe ekler. |
| static BoxValue(System::SharedPtr<T>) | Tür referansını nesne değerine dönüştürme. |
| Clear() override | Tüm öğeleri siler. |
| Contains(SharedPtr<System::Object>) const override | Öğenin listede bulunup bulunmadığını kontrol eder. |
| get_Count() const override | ICollection.get_Count() metotların uygulanması Koleksiyondaki öğe sayısını alır. |
| GetEnumerator() override | IEnumerable.GetEnumerator() uygulanması Bir koleksiyon üzerinde yineleme yapan bir enumerator döndürür. |
| idx_get(int, int) const override | Belirtilen indeksteki öğeyi alır. |
| IListImplRefType(System::SharedPtr<System::Collections::Generic::List<System::SharedPtr<T>>>) | Yeni bir nesne örneği oluşturur. |
| IndexOf(System::SharedPtr<System::Object>) const override | Öğenin konteynerdeki ilk görünümünün indeksini alır. |
| Insert(int, System::SharedPtr<System::Object>) override | Öğeyi belirtilen konuma ekler, diğer öğeleri kaydırır. |
| Remove(SharedPtr<System::Object>) override | Belirli bir öğenin listeden ilk örneğini kaldırır. |
| RemoveAt(int) override | Belirtilen konumdaki öğeyi kaldırır. |
| static UnboxValue(System::SharedPtr<System::Object>) | Nesne değerini belirli bir tür referansına dönüştürme. |
Ayrıca Bakınız
- Class IList
- Namespace System::Collections
- Library Aspose.Font for C++